Sustainable Infrastructure in Alabama

Across the Southeast and here in our home state of Alabama, various sustainable infrastructure projects are both being developed and in the works. The Rebuild Alabama Act provides funding for road and bridge improvements across the state, with focus on generating economic growth and reinforcing safety on the state’s roadways. Additionally, the Bipartisan Infrastructure Law (BIL) offers funds for public transit, electric vehicle (EV) charging networks and rail improvements, which supports inclusive transportation options and aims to protect the environment. The BIL also provides grants for communities to improve drinking water, wastewater, and stormwater systems to protect environmental and human health by addressing dangerous contaminants.

In this part of the country, special consideration is made for potential regional hazards like hurricanes, floods, tornadoes, wildfires and other natural disasters when infrastructure projects are developed. One example is here in our own backyard, the I-10 Mobile River Bridge and Bayway, which is a large project to replace the low-lying Bayway with elevated bridges for storm resilience and better clearance for ships. New interchanges will also help motorists have an easier time navigating between Mobile and Baldwin Counties.

Managing the Treatment and Disposal of Hazardous Waste

October 13, 2025

 

The City of Mobile recently hosted a free household hazardous waste collection event for its residents. Household hazardous waste includes items that are not routinely picked up by bulk trash and garbage collection services, as they can be harmful to the environment and to humans if not disposed of properly. Both personal households and businesses have a responsibility to their communities to minimize the impact their waste, particularly hazardous waste, has on the environment.

What is Hazardous Waste?

While common household items like paint, batteries, cleaners, fertilizers and medications often come to mind when discussing hazardous waste, industry is also a major contributor to hazardous waste issues. Many industrial manufacturing processes can produce hazardous waste in a variety of forms, including liquids, solids, gases and sludges. The Environmental Protection Agency (EPA) developed a regulatory definition and process that identifies hazardous substances and how they should be managed.

Industries that are prone to hazardous waste production include:

  • Construction
  • Dry Cleaning
  • Educational and Vocational Shops (Automobile repair, Woodworking, Metalworking)
  • Equipment Repair
  • Furniture Manufacturing and Refinishing
  • Laboratories
  • Textile Manufacturing
  • Transportation (Freight and Railroad)
  • Pesticide Application and Cleanup
  • Printing and Photo Processing
  • Vehicle Maintenance

Companies in these industries must determine if they produce hazardous waste and, if so, must oversee waste processing, treatment and recycling or disposal. Examples of industrial hazardous waste include solvents, paints, pesticides, heavy metals and more.

Disposal and Recycling of Hazardous Waste

Regulations at both the federal and state levels are in place to help businesses recycle or dispose of hazardous waste properly. At the federal level, the EPA manages various standards, exclusions and exemptions for categories of hazardous waste – it is up to the business to understand the waste it produces and the regulations that apply in their industry and geographic location.

Proper disposal of hazardous industrial waste is critical to preserving the environment – especially drinking water – and protecting people from various toxins that can cause severe illness. Air, soil, water and wildlife are affected when hazardous waste disposal goes awry. Businesses can avoid costly fines and tarnished reputations by having a disposal plan in place.

Hazardous waste recycling is managed by its own set of regulations at the federal and state levels. When a material is reused, reclaimed or used in a way that constitutes disposal and burned for energy recovery, it is recycled. These approaches can reduce environmental hazards and protect natural resources.

At home, take-back programs like the one offered by the City of Mobile are ideal for disposing of household hazardous wastes. Residents should contact their municipal or county utilities office to find out more about local policies, regulations and disposal programs.

Create an Eco-Friendly Culture

Buy-in from employees is a critical component of successful green office efforts. Educating employees about how they can play a role in sustainability efforts during their day-to-day work is a great first step. Encourage recycling, reusable water bottles, turning off electronics at the end of the day, environmentally conscious transportation and other small habits that, when added up, foster an eco-friendly culture.

Additionally, investing in environmentally friendly daily-use equipment can indicate to employees that the company takes sustainability seriously. Using hybrid or solar power systems, low-pressure water systems and rainwater collection tanks at the office are good places to start and can help lower utility costs over time.

For companies that operate machinery, water recycling can be an excellent option to cool systems and wash equipment while reducing operating and utility costs. Efficient use of water can also help conserve resources and save money – this could include operating water-based machinery when fully loaded, turning the air conditioning off when not in use and only using cooling equipment when necessary.
